Dragon's Blood Sedum Care Guide

Sedum spurium

ground_coverZones 3–9deer resistant

Low-spreading succulent with rounded leaves that turn deep burgundy-red in cool weather. Clusters of starry pink flowers in summer. Thrives in the poorest, driest soils.

Season-by-season care

Spring

Remove winter debris Early spring

Clear any dead leaves or debris from the mat of foliage.

Summer

Propagate easily Anytime in growing season

Sedum roots from any stem piece. Pull sections and press into soil to fill gaps.

Fall

Enjoy red foliage Fall

Cool weather intensifies the deep burgundy foliage color.
